whoopsie-daisy 0.1.19 source package in Ubuntu

Changelog

whoopsie-daisy (0.1.19) precise; urgency=low

  * Handle errors in parsing the crash database URL.
  * Do not double-free the crash database core submission URL when a
    system UUID is not present (LP: #960972).
  * Handle errors in bson_append_string.
  * Handle more BSON error conditions.
  * Handle empty values in the apport format ("KeyName:\n")
    (LP: #960766, LP: #960737, LP: #960751).
